dimanche 14 mars 2010

Astuce: créer un .deb à partir d'une application déjà installée

Imaginons que vous vouliez installer une application sur un autre poste de travail ou simplement la filer à un ami mais que vous vous ne souveniez plus du site où vous l'avez télécharger...
Si cette application est toujours installée sur votre système , vous pouvez facilement re-créer un fichier .deb à l'aide de dpkg-repack.
Dans un terminal, commencer par installer dpkg-repack:
sudo apt-get install dpkg-repack

Puis taper dans un terminal:
sudo dpkg-repack le_nom_du_paquet_à_recréer

exemple avec le paquet "tucan"
sudo dpkg-repack tucan
dpkg-deb: building package `tucan' in `./tucan_0.3.9-1~getdeb2_amd64.deb'.

Par défaut dpkg-repack utilise l'architecture donnée par "dpkg  --print-architecture" mais il est possible de modifier l'architecture avec l'option --arch=arch, par exemple pour une architecture amd64:
sudo dpkg-repack --arch=amd64  le_nom_du_paquet_à_recréer.

Astuce Butinée: IcI 

.

1 commentaire:

  1. C'est bon ça. Merci ;)

    Y'a une question qui me turlupine, il intègre les dépendances avec dans paquet ?

    RépondreSupprimer